Colors of Progress: Sarojini Nagar’s Holi shines brighter with development initiatives: CM Yogi

Lucknow :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ath attended the ‘3 Years of Excellence, Sarojini Nagar Gratitude Day’ event organized by MLA Dr Rajeshwar Singh at Dr Ram Manohar Lohia Law University on Monday. During the event, the Chief Minister inaugurated and laid the foundation stones for multiple development projects and explored the Sarojini Nagar Samvad and Development Exhibition. Sikh families from Sarojini Nagar also presented him with prasad from Kartarpur Sahib.

Highlighting the festive spirit, CM Yogi remarked that combining vibrant colours and development initiatives has made Holi in Sarojini Nagar even more joyful. He noted that the occasion coincided with Rangbhari Ekadashi, with temples celebrating by playing Holi with idols of deities.

The Chief Minister announced that projects worth Rs 32,000 crore have either been completed or are in progress. He said, “Among these, a Rs 1,200 crore convention center with a seating capacity of 10,000 people is set to be constructed. The constituency will also house a defence corridor, Uttar Pradesh’s first forensic institute, and a medical facility comparable to SGPGI.”

During the event, the Chief Minister inaugurated and laid the foundation stones for numerous development projects in Sarojini Nagar. He presented tablets to five meritorious students — Anushka, Harsh Maurya, Preeti Singh, Mallika Arora, and Krishna Sahu — and distributed 25 bicycles to other deserving students.

Additionally, libraries were provided to five RWAs, sports kits were provided to five youth clubs, and smart class panels were provided to 15 schools and colleges. The CM also inaugurated open gyms in five parks, presented a trophy to the winning team of the Sarojini Sports League, and launched the 11th Ran Bahadur Singh Digital Education and Empowerment Center.

The development initiatives further included the renovation of 25 temples, the inauguration of statues of Lord Parshuram and the late Kalyan Singh, and various projects at old age homes, demonstrating a comprehensive approach to uplift the region’s infrastructure and welfare standards.
